We are currently in process of converting our last 2 WHMreseller servers to WHMPHP. We currently use both ZamFoo and now WHMPHP on our servers and they each have their advantages. ZamFoo and WHMPHP are certainly much better then WHMreseller, both in functionality and features.

Posted by Siterack_net, 07-24-2010, 12:14 AM
When I first started, I was using WHMPHP, but after they updated the version, I wasn;t happy that my customers had to login through cPanel to create reseller accounts. It just didn;t make sense, so I switched to Zamfoo, which maintains master reseller ability through the WHM interface Of course, that was a while ago, maybe WHMPHP has changed back, but I haven't used it since, to know
